From the author of A Book of One’s Own and Stolen Words
comes a delightful and wide-ranging investigation of the
art of letter writing. Yours Ever explores the offhand masterpieces dispatched
through the ages by messenger, postal service, and
BlackBerry. Thomas Mallon weaves a remarkable assortment of
epistolary riches into his own insightful and eloquent
commentary on the circumstances and characters of the
world’s most intriguing letter writers. Here are Madame de
Sévigné’s devastatingly sharp reports from the court of
Louis XIV, F. Scott Fitzgerald’s tormented advice to his
young daughter, the besotted midlife billets-doux of a
suddenly rejuvenated Woodrow Wilson, the casually brilliant
spiritual musings of Flannery O’Connor, the lustful
boastings of Lord Byron, the cries from prison of Sacco and
Vanzetti. Along with the confessions and complaints and
revelations sent from battlefields, frontier cabins, and
luxury liners, a reader will find Mallon considering travel
bulletins, suicide notes, fan letters, and hate mail–forms
as varied as the human experiences behind them. Yours Ever is an exuberant reintroduction to a vast and
entertaining literature–a book that will help to revive, in
the digital age, this glorious lost art.
